Yes, the area where you draw and create in Paint 3D is called the Canvas.

Understanding the Paint 3D Canvas

In Paint 3D, the primary space where all your artistic creations come to life is known as the Canvas. As the reference states, the Canvas is the area where you can create or draw your shape. This is where you'll add 2D elements, apply textures, place 3D models, and arrange all the components of your project.

The Canvas acts as the background or base for your work. You can often adjust its size, aspect ratio, and even make it transparent, depending on your project needs. It's the fundamental space within the Paint 3D environment where you build and edit your scenes.

Tools Used on the Canvas

To draw and paint on the Canvas, Paint 3D provides various tools. One such tool mentioned in the reference is the Brushes option.

  • Brushes Option: This tool allows you to apply various brush strokes and effects directly onto the Canvas. The reference specifically notes that the Brushes option displays two sliders for the Thickness and Opacity, allowing you to control how your brush strokes appear on the drawing area.

Using these tools, you interact directly with the Canvas to shape, color, and modify your artwork.
